State ex Rel. Youngblood v. Bagert

Supreme Court of Louisiana
Nov 5, 1986
496 So. 2d 338 (La. 1986)

Opinion

No. 86-KH-2095.

November 5, 1986.

In re Youngblood, Arthur; applying for writ of mandamus; Parish of Orleans, Criminal District Court, Div. "H".


Granted. The district court is ordered to act, if it has not already done so, on the post conviction petition submitted by relator.
